Uvalde Mayor admits an unidentified 'negotiator' tried to contact the teen gunman during horror attack
Uvalde's mayor Don McLaughlin revealed Wednesday that a negotiator tried to contact gunman Salvador Ramos during the shooting. 'His main goal was to try to get this person on the phone,' McLaughlin said in an interview with The Washington Post and Telemundo San Antonio Wednesday. 'They tried every number they could find,' he told the outlets in the sit-down interview, held at Uvalde's City Hall.
